Tysnes Church (Norwegian: Tysnes kyrkje) is a parish church in Tysnes municipality in Hordaland county, Norway. It is located in the village of Våge on the northern shore of the island of Tysnesøya. The church is part of the Tysnes parish in the Sunnhordland deanery in the Diocese of Bjørgvin. The white, wooden church was built in 1867 by the architect Georg Andreas Bull. The church, which seats about 400 people, was consecrated on 4 September 1867.[1][2][3]
